Freeradius2 no inicia automaticamente
-
php: rc.bootup: ROUTING: setting default route to 192.168.1.1
kernel: done.
kernel: done.
kernel: done.
check_reload_status: Updating all dyndns
kernel: ipfw2 (+ipv6) initialized, divert loadable, nat loadable, default to accept, logging disabled
lighttpd[47330]: (log.c.194) server started
php: rc.bootup: Creating rrd update script
syslogd: exiting on signal 15
syslogd: kernel boot file is /boot/kernel/kernel
kernel: done.
kernel: done.
php-fpm[246]: /rc.start_packages: The command '/usr/local/etc/rc.d/radiusd.sh stop' returned exit code '1', the output was 'radiusd not running?'
radiusd[77720]: Loaded virtual server <default>radiusd[84624]: Ready to process requests.
radiusd[84624]: Signalled to terminate
radiusd[84624]: Exiting normally.
php-fpm[246]: /rc.start_packages: The command '/usr/local/etc/rc.d/radiusd.sh stop' returned exit code '1', the output was 'radiusd not running?'
php-fpm[246]: /rc.start_packages: The command '/usr/local/etc/rc.d/radiusd.sh stop' returned exit code '1', the output was 'radiusd not running?'
php-fpm[246]: /rc.start_packages: The command '/usr/local/etc/rc.d/radiusd.sh stop' returned exit code '1', the output was 'radiusd not running?'
php-fpm[246]: /rc.start_packages: The command '/usr/local/etc/rc.d/radiusd.sh stop' returned exit code '1', the output was 'radiusd not running?'
php-fpm[246]: /rc.start_packages: The command '/usr/local/etc/rc.d/radiusd.sh stop' returned exit code '1', the output was 'radiusd not running?'
php-fpm[246]: /rc.start_packages: The command '/usr/local/etc/rc.d/radiusd.sh stop' returned exit code '1', the output was 'radiusd not running?'
php-fpm[246]: /rc.start_packages: The command '/usr/local/etc/rc.d/radiusd.sh stop' returned exit code '1', the output was 'radiusd not running?'
login: login on ttyv0 as rootcada vez que reinicia el servidor tengo que iniciar el radius manualmente (copie el log que me da) alguien sabe como solucionarlo? o la fuente donde esta la solucion… gracias</default>
-
Nosotros teníamos ese problema. Lo que veíamos es que el servicio inicia correctamente, pero el script de arranque después va y lo para. :o
Lo resolvimos con un watchdog.
Hay un hilo en inglés https://forum.pfsense.org/index.php?topic=87441.msg546710#msg546710Instalas el paquete "Service Watchdog"
Te vas a Services - Service Watchdog y añades el servicio freeradius a la lista de servicios monitorizados.
El Watchdog vigila que los servicios en su lista estén arrancados siempre.
Si no los ven arrancados los arranca.
De esta forma al iniciar el sistema, como el watchdog detecta el freeradius no está iniciado, te lo arranca. Nosotros tenemos este servicio monitorizado por lo mismo que dices tu, y el DNS Forwarder porque con la cantidad de usuarios que tenemos, en ocasiones nos cruje.